Family remembers 12 year old son with balloon release
STONEWALL, Miss. (WTOK) - Wednesday, Caleb Bender was remembered through a balloon release at Stonewall baseball field. The family of Bender and the Clarke County community came out as a sign of respect for Bender, wearing red, his favorite color, and shouting the number twelve in recognition of his age at death.

Heirs of Godbolt victim receive millions in wrongful death lawsuit
LINCOLN COUNTY, Miss. (WJTV) – Three family members of a Mississippi woman, who was killed in 2017, were awarded millions of dollars in a wrongful death lawsuit against the convicted killer. The Daily Leader reported the heirs of Sheila Burage, a victim of Willie Corey Godbolt, filed a lawsuit in May 2018 seeking punitive damages […]

Salaries for two public university presidents creep toward $1 million a year
Two public university presidents in Mississippi now make almost $1 million a year each while pay for faculty and staff at the state’s eight universities remains stagnant. The hefty salaries are largely, but not entirely, due to the private foundations for the University of Mississippi and Mississippi State University supplementing the state salaries for Glenn Boyce and Mark Keenum, respectively.
Three arrested in months-long investigation of Roxicodone drug distribution in Mississippi
Three people have been arrested for distributing large amounts of drugs after a months-long investigation by a Mississippi Special Operations Group. The Natchez Democrat reports that Agents with the Adams County Special Operations Group seized nine vehicles and thousands of dollars in cash, as well as narcotics with a street value of approximately $20,000.
